About this position
Location: Donahoo Farm and Warehouse
Reports to: Shipping and Receiving Manager
Works With: Warehouse Lead, Buyers, Team Members
Leads: Team Members
The role of the Receiving Supervisor is to oversee the receiving, transferring, and tagging of products while ensuring the smooth operation of the Donahoo Warehouse Receiving Department. This position requires strong communication, organization, attention to detail, and effective leadership to maintain the integrity of data, which is essential for operational success. Responsibilities are prioritized according to a hierarchy of tasks established by the manager, allowing the position to operate with a level of autonomy, in partnership with store needs, the timeliness of order receipts, and the overall schedule for receiving items. While the Receiving Supervisor is the main point of contact for receiving products shipping to the warehouse, collaboration is key, and assistance may be required during urgent situations.

Essential Functions:
- Work in varying weather conditions including hot, cold, wet or dry environments.
- Work on a variety of surfaces including, but not limited to, gravel, concrete, mud, or dirt.
- This position routinely requires employees to individually lift, carry, and maneuver heavy or awkward items that may exceed 50 pounds. Employees must use proper lifting techniques, follow all training and safety procedures, and exercise sound judgment when determining whether a load can be handled safely. When an item is too heavy, bulky, or unstable to lift alone, employees are expected to request assistance or use available mechanical aids to prevent injury.
- Must be available to work 8: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m., five days per week (typically Monday–Friday). Flexibility to work additional hours, including occasional extended shifts or a sixth day during peak business periods, is required as workload demands.
- Stand and walk on your feet for multiple hours at a time with breaks as required by law.
- Receive products and enter new items as instructed by leadership.
- Operate effectively in a high-paced setting involving various individuals and teams.
- Print tags, maintain accurate item numbers and UPC Maintenance and Data Cleanup.
- Execute Inter-store transfers.

Additional Expectations:
- Review receiving emails and communicate effectively using the Teams app and other programs as directed by leadership.
- Maintain awareness of incoming products and their status in the receiving process.
- Unpack and check incoming freight for accuracy and condition.
- Report any order, packing slip, or invoice discrepancies to Shipping and Receiving Manager and Buyers, and assist in resolving issues such as damage, shortages, or overages.
- Report breakage, shortages, and overages to vendors as needed.
- Collaborate with Buyers and Merchandisers to ensure products are ready to display.
- Collaborate with Warehouse Lead regarding warehouse order processing and receiving.
- Communicate with Warehouse Lead and Production Coordinators regarding packing and shipment of products going to the stores.
- Maintain proficiency in Microsoft Excel.
- Execute correct tag procedure (location on product and what type of tag), scan barcodes for accuracy prior to tagging product, and various other receiving tasks.
- Enter shrinkage and store use in VMX when appropriate.
- Assist with warehouse inventory processes as needed.
- Safely and proficiently operate various equipment including electric and manual pallet jacks, forklift and pallet wrapper.
- Maintain cleanliness and organization in receiving areas, including the warehouse, greenhouse, parking lot, and retail stores.
- Answer phone calls professionally and courteously.
- Possess knowledge of cashier and register procedures.
- Manage ordering of price gun and tag machine supplies.
- Perform various other tasks as directed by leadership.
- Assist on the Production side of the Donahoo Farm which may include assisting with inventory, flagging, pulling orders, planting or other tasks as designated that day.
- Assist with unloading large shipments that require extra man power to aid in efficiency and getting trucks off the warehouse dock in a timely manner.
